Family History
From the 1920s to the late 1940s, this was the home of Charles Thomas Lee. Charles was born in England in 1885 and married his wife, Birdie Helen La Frenz, in 1916 in Davenport. Charles was a master mechanic for the railroad, and Birdie was active in civic affairs. The couple lived in the home with their son, Robert, and an aunt of Birdie’s. After the death of Charles in 1941, Birdie and now an adult Robert moved out of the home. Birdie became an office worker for a social agency and Robert worked in an office for farm implements.
